Story
Joanne has spent most, if not all, of her life surviving outdoors. She was discovered by a Good Samaritan living under a porch, and thankfully brought inside where she could finally be safe and warm! When Joanne first arrived at the shelter, she was absolutely terrified...and also very spicy! Life indoors was a huge adjustment after years of fending for herself. With time, patience, and a soft place to land, Joanne has settled in… though her signature sass is here to stay! She has a very distinctive screech that she uses to announce when she wants food or attention! She lives to be petted( until she suddenly doesn’t!) and she’s not shy about delivering a warning bite if you miss her cues! Joanne is a moody little fluffball who will thrive with an experienced, cat-savvy caregiver who respects her boundaries and doesn’t mind taking orders! She does not like other cats and will need to be the one and only, ruling her home as the true queen she is!

Story
You can fill out an adoption application online on our official website.Hi! My name is Thomas O’Malley, and I might just be the sweetest boy you’ll ever meet! I’m still technically a kitten, though I’m a big one—and my foster parents think I’m just about done growing. I’ve made lots of friends in my foster home: other cats, a gentle giant of a dog, a baby, my foster parents, and all their visitors. I love everyone. I’m an affectionate guy who will happily curl up in your lap for pets, and I even like to perch on your shoulders for extra closeness. I’ve also discovered the joy of toys—springs are my absolute favorite, but a good toy mouse can keep me entertained too! I’d be happy in just about any home, as long as there’s plenty of love and attention to go around. I’m great at sharing that attention with other cats or dogs, so I’d do well with furry siblings too. I can’t wait to meet my forever family!
